Discover the Iconic Golden Gate Bridge

Despite standing as a symbol of engineering mastery, the Golden Gate Bridge also offers breathtaking views and a unique experience for visitors. Extending approximately 1.7 miles, this iconic structure unites San Francisco to Marin County, presenting its vivid International Orange hue against the sapphire waters of the bay. Strolling or cycling across the bridge allows guests to fully enjoy its greatness and panoramic vistas of the city skyline, Alcatraz Island, and the Pacific Ocean.

Guests regularly photograph stunning photographs at multiple viewpoints, each providing a varied perspective of the bridge's impressive towers and sweeping cables. The surrounding Golden Gate National Park delivers opportunities for further exploration, with trails leading to scenic overlooks. As the sun sets, the bridge transforms under the warm glow of twilight, making it a perfect spot for both reflection and adventure. The Golden Gate Bridge remains an unforgettable experience for all who venture to San Francisco.

Iconic Sea Lions

At Pier 39, an animated display takes place as sea lions lounge in the sunshine, delighting visitors with their spirited antics. This iconic attraction has become a signature feature of San Francisco, drawing eager crowds to witness the unique behavior of these marine mammals. The sea lions, often observed resting on the floating docks, engage in playful sparring, vocalizations, and sunbathing, creating a charming environment. Their presence not only enchants visitors but also symbolizes the natural beauty of the area. Conservational efforts have helped protect these animals, ensuring they remain a fixture of the San Francisco experience. For families, photographers, and nature enthusiasts alike, the sea lions at Pier 39 offer an unforgettable glimpse into the vibrant marine life of the California coast.

Experience the Vibrancy of Chinatown

Consider diving into the vibrant culture of San Francisco's Chinatown, the oldest and one of the largest Chinese communities outside Asia? This vibrant neighborhood offers an array of sights, sounds, and tastes that reflect its rich heritage. Visitors can explore vibrant streets featuring traditional architecture, including the iconic Dragon Gate entrance. The aroma of authentic Chinese cuisine permeates the atmosphere, inviting passersby to sample hand-pulled noodles, dim sum, and Peking duck at local eateries.

Customers can find one-of-a-kind shops offering everything from medicinal herbs to intricate silk garments. Cultural events frequently take place, commemorating festivals like the Lunar New Year, where lion dances and fireworks enliven the streets to life. Additionally, the Chinatown alleyways expose hidden gems, including art galleries and tea shops. This vibrant enclave not only highlights Chinese culture but also fosters a sense of community that fascinates every visitor.

Savor the Scenic Splendor of Golden Gate Park

After exploring the dynamic atmosphere of Chinatown, a visit to Golden Gate Park provides a peaceful contrast filled with natural beauty and recreational options. Stretching across over a thousand acres, the park is a refuge for nature aficionados and outdoor enthusiasts alike. Visitors can meander through verdant gardens, such as the Japanese Tea Garden, which features breathtaking landscapes and serene ponds. The park's twisting trails present an ideal setting for leisurely strolls or stimulating jogs, while the vast lawns welcome picnics and relaxation.

For those seeking adventure, the park provides activities including paddle boating on Stow Lake and cycling along its beautiful paths. Wildlife enthusiasts might spot different bird species and other fauna in their natural habitat. All in all, Golden Gate Park serves as a serene escape from the city's hustle, allowing visitors to reconnect with nature and partake in an array of outdoor activities.

Experience Prestigious Museums and Art Galleries

San Francisco features an exceptional collection of top-tier museums helpful guide and art galleries that serve wide-ranging interests and tastes. The celebrated San Francisco Museum of Modern Art (SFMOMA) displays an vast collection of contemporary art, engaging visitors with its innovative exhibitions. The de Young Museum, nestled in Golden Gate Park, offers a vibrant blend of American art from the 17th through the 21st centuries, together with important international pieces.

For those interested in scientific and historical subjects, the California Academy of Sciences offers an engaging experience with its planetarium, aquarium, and natural history displays. In the meantime, the Asian Art Museum features one of the most thorough collections of Asian art in the world, allowing visitors to delve into rich cultural histories. Art enthusiasts can also locate inspiration in the many smaller galleries distributed throughout neighborhoods like the Mission District and North Beach, featuring local artistic talent and emerging artists.

Embark on a Scenic Ride on Cable Cars

One of the quintessential adventures in San Francisco is riding on the famous cable cars. These iconic vehicles deliver a distinctive perspective of the city's stunning landscapes and architectural beauty. As the cable cars ascend and descend the dramatic hills, visitors can experience magnificent views of the Golden Gate Bridge, Alcatraz Island, and the vibrant neighborhoods below.

The rhythmic clanging of the bells and the nostalgic charm of the wooden cars evoke a sense of history, reminding passengers of the cable cars' enduring importance since the late 19th century. With several lines covering key areas, such as Powell-Hyde and Powell-Mason, visitors can easily get on and off to explore various attractions. Riding a cable car not only provides an exhilarating experience but also connects travelers to the city's culture and heritage, making it a unmissable activity while visiting San Francisco.

When Should You Visit San Francisco?

The ideal time to visit San Francisco is throughout late spring or early fall. These times provide mild weather, diminished crowds, and sunny skies, enhancing the experience of exploring the city's renowned attractions and areas.

Does San Francisco Have Any Free Attractions?

Yes, San Francisco offers many free attractions, including the iconic Golden Gate Park, the Cable Car Museum, and the Fisherman's Wharf. Guests can also discover the colorful Mission District murals and enjoy the breathtaking views from Twin Peaks.

How Do I Get Around the City Easily?

To move through San Francisco effortlessly, travelers can employ public transportation options such as Muni buses and BART trains, get around on foot, or rent bicycles. App-based ride services also offer convenient alternatives for getting to different locations throughout the city.
